got my supercharger kit last week and started the tear-down. within a couple days i had everything removed and the supercharger base plate attached.
Note: i forgot to purge the fuel system, so it took me a while to soak up all the gas that leaked out of my fuel rail. to purge the fuel system, pull the fuel pump fuse and start the car. let it run til it stalls. then open the gas cap to release the pressure in the tank.

bit of an update.
the blower and idler pulley are on, and the belt is run. i had to move some brackets and gently heat and indent the right side distributor cover to make cleaance for the belt.
things are on hold right now, as it is really cold (-20 to -30 celcius)
